Me+ Lifestyle Routine alternatives

Me+ Lifestyle Routine users often seek alternatives due to its aggressive paywall for basic features and recurring technical issues. Many find the app's core functionality, like adding more than a few tasks, is locked behind a subscription, leading to frustration and a search for more accessible options.

Finch
4.9★ · 725,099 ratings · Free

Finch is a self-care app that helps users with routines, hygiene, and nutrition by allowing them to care for a virtual pet, a 'birb' . It encourages daily tasks and goal setting, making self-care feel more engaging R58.

Better for: Finch is better for users who are motivated by gamification and a sense of responsibility, as they take care of a virtual pet while also taking care of themselves . It's also recommended by a Me+ user as an alternative that allows routine creation even with VIP, suggesting it might have a more accessible free tier for basic routines R28. However, some users note that many items for the birb are expensive or require premium, and long-term goals were removed in an update R52R53R64.

Habit Tracker
4.8★ · 143,576 ratings · Free

Habit Tracker is described as a simple, powerful, and intuitive app for tracking habits, helping users stay organized and become better individuals R80R85. It allows users to track habits daily and can include minute-based tracking R80.

Better for: This app is better for users who prefer a straightforward, minimalist approach to habit tracking without extra features R80. It's particularly useful for those who want to establish and maintain good habits over a long period R80. However, similar to Me+, some users report that only a limited number of habits (e.g., six) are available for free, requiring a subscription for more R81. There are also reports of syncing issues between devices and problems with premium subscriptions not being recognized R86.

Routine Planner
4.7★ · 17,264 ratings · Free

Routine Planner helps users manage routines and create good habits, particularly aiding those with executive dysfunction or ADHD by guiding them through tasks sequentially R95. It helps users plan out their day and stay on task .

Better for: Routine Planner is ideal for individuals who struggle with executive dysfunction or ADHD and benefit from a structured, step-by-step approach to routines R95. It helps in managing daily energy and avoiding feeling overwhelmed . However, users note that only a limited number of routines (e.g., two) are free, with a subscription required for more R94. Some users also reported glitches, freezing, and issues with automatic progression between steps R93.

Frequently asked

Why do users consider Me+ Lifestyle Routine to be 'money hungry'?
Users consider Me+ Lifestyle Routine to be 'money hungry' because many essential features, such as adding more than 5-8 tasks or routines, are locked behind a mandatory subscription, and some users report unexpected charges or being forced into trials R3R7R10R13.
What are the common technical issues with Me+ Lifestyle Routine?
Common technical issues with Me+ Lifestyle Routine include the app freezing, not loading past the initial screen, AI features failing to work, and problems with subscriptions not being recognized or loaded R4R7R19R31.
